Impinging of metallic nanoparticles along with the slip effects through a porous medium with MHD

Content Provider SpringerLink
Author shahzadi, Iqra Nadeem, S.
Copyright Year 2017
Abstract The considered analysis comprises the effects of nanoparticles on the characteristics of the peristaltic flow through a homogeneous porous medium under the impact of magnetic field and slip effects by considering an appropriate mathematical model. Analysis is introduced by considering blood as the base fluid and metals such as copper and silver as the nanoparticles in the existence of the thermal and velocity slip effects. Lubrication approach is used to simplify the problem. Impact of related parameters on temperature, pressure rise, pressure gradient, velocity and streamlines are interpreted graphically. Comparison of the pure blood, silver blood and copper blood is presented and analyzed. It is also revealed that inclusion of nanoparticles scales down the velocity and temperature of fluid. Another valuable finding of the present investigation is that the silver nanoparticles enhance the pressure gradient when compared with the copper nanoparticles. Therefore, the current investigation is capable to achieve some essential and interesting characteristics in few biomedical applications.
